Dr Ben Yip's Story

sample_img

Dr Ben Yip
PhD Graduate (2011) from the Department of Rehabilitation Sciences

 

Dr Ben Yip graduated with a PhD in Occupational Therapy from PolyU's Department of Rehabilitation Sciences in 2011 under the supervision of Prof. David Man.  He has successfully completed numerous research and development (R&D) projects that are of high applicability and sustainability and is leading companies in impactful knowledge transfer.  He set up his own company, C2 Innovations & Research Ltd., in 2011, and jointly developed the virtual reality-based rehabilitation system "VRehab" with Prof. Man as a result of his PhD research.  In February 2020, Dr Yip also became CEO of Rehab-Robotics Co. Ltd., a Hong Kong-based medical-grade device manufacturer with ISO 13485 certification founded by PolyU occupational therapy alumnus Mr Michael Tsui.

 

Among Rehab-Robotics Co. Ltd.'s innovative hardware- or software-based rehabilitation products is the internationally award-winning "Hand of Hope" (HOH), a robotic glove system for post-stroke hand-function rehabilitation, which was jointly developed with PolyU biomedical engineering scholars in 2010.  Dr Yip's vision of "Development for the better living of mankind" has led to the evolution of a portable and more affordable version 2.0 of the HOH.  Spurred by the global COVID-19 pandemic, Dr Yip's team has quickly upgraded the HOH system with an add-on distance-training capacity to benefit clients around the world.  He aims to launch version 3.0 of the HOH in 2021 with intelligent medicine, Big Data and cloud-based capabilities.


Dr Yip personally owns one patent, and has facilitated four company-owned patents, four patents under application, and more than 10 worldwide trademarks.  He has won four licence agreements with PolyU.  Dr Yip continues to lead the company's worldwide sales and marketing in more than 15 countries with 10 local and international distributers, and plans to broaden the company's scope to developing rehabilitation products for the home and for the gerontechnology equipment rental market.
